    FAQs:

    Q: How tall do pawpaw trees grow?
    A: Pawpaw trees can reach up to 25 feet tall when mature, making them great for landscaping and shade.

    Q: When do pawpaw trees bloom?
    A: These trees bloom in mid-April with beautiful flowers before producing fruit.

    Q: How should I plant my pawpaw tree seedlings?
    A: Plant in deep, fertile soil in a location with partial to full sunlight. Water regularly for best results.

    Q: How long does it take for pawpaw trees to produce fruit?
    A: Typically, pawpaw trees start bearing fruit within 4-7 years, depending on growing conditions.

    Q: Are pawpaw trees easy to maintain?
    A: Yes! They require minimal maintenance, thrive in rich soil, and are generally pest-resistant.
